CppCheck : memcpy did not copy all data as intended

This commit is contained in:
Magne Sjaastad 2018-08-03 07:12:40 +02:00
parent fe07b60392
commit 5bbc0ee89f

View File

@ -86,7 +86,7 @@ void RivEclipseIntersectionGrid::cellCornerVertices(size_t cellIndex, cvf::Vec3d
void RivEclipseIntersectionGrid::cellCornerIndices(size_t cellIndex, size_t cornerIndices[8]) const
{
const caf::SizeTArray8& cornerIndicesSource = m_mainGrid->globalCellArray()[cellIndex].cornerIndices();
memcpy(cornerIndices, cornerIndicesSource.data(), 8);
memcpy(cornerIndices, cornerIndicesSource.data(), 8 * sizeof(size_t));
}
//--------------------------------------------------------------------------------------------------